Several Hillcrest students have been caught using their phones when they are not supposed to, such as during class or in the school hallways. Some students have even filmed their activities and posted them on social media platforms, despite school policies prohibiting such behavior.
This has caused concern among teachers, administrators, and parents because it violates school rules and threatens safety risks. School teachers have reminded students of the importance of following school policies and respecting others' privacy.
We encourage parents to talk to their children about the responsible use of technology and how to monitor their social media activity to ensure they are not threatening any school policies or rules.
This problem is making many people feel unsafe because a few of the films have had random kids or teachers in the schoolyard or in the hallways. Right now no phones are allowed out from 8:30-2:50, or on Wednesday/minimum days: 8:30-1:30.
